Однако это место при этом не должно быть общедоступным. Безопаснее использовать определенные средства защиты, такие как защита паролем, аутентификация JWT или шифрование данных. Следуйте приведенным ниже советам, и вы обеспечите своих коллег ценными и полными ресурсами по тестированию ПО. Когда вы проверяете выполнимость требований, посмотрите, можно ли это вообще сделать в рамках существующих ограничений.
Технический писатель может помогать оформлять такие документы, чтобы они были понятны для всех участников процесса разработки. В ходе работы над технической документацией тестировщик взаимодействует не только с разработчиками, но и с техническими писателями. При правильной организации рабочего процесса это сотрудничество должно происходить на разных этапах жизненного цикла документации. Документы по тестированию программного обеспечения всегда играют важную роль на этапе разработки/тестирования проекта. Поэтому всегда документируйте все, когда это возможно.
Конечно, этот пример пренебрежения испытаниями не относится к области информационных технологий. Однако он наглядно демонстрирует важность тестирования, в том числе и в области ИТ, где материальный ущерб может быть более значительным. Крушение ракеты-носителя Space Shuttle Challenger в 1986 году стало для США синонимом оглушительного провала. Это не только повлекло огромные финансовые потери, но и нанесло серьезный репутационный ущерб на политической арене (в контексте космической гонки с СССР).
Этапы Тестирования Требований
А то бывает так, что разработчик уже всё сделал, и тут только тестировщик понимает, что задачу никак нельзя проверить. Или можно проверить вручную, но нельзя написать автотесты, фреймворк под новый функционал не заточен. И такой выбор возможностей поиска — это именно компромис для скорости и потребляемых ресурсов под сценарии Разработка программного обеспечения использования.
Проработка Требований К Продукту
Здесь вы можете найти информацию обо всем, что нужно сделать тестировщику или команде QA в ходе проекта. Если тестирование не документируется, это мешает увидеть полную картину проекта. Без четких целей, пошагового плана по их достижению и указания всех важных условий ожидаемый результат будет неясен. В таких условиях у всех может быть разное понимание общей цели и конечного продукта. Управление дефектами может стать настоящей головной болью без применения соответствующих решений.
Когда дело дошло до меня, у меня на руках было доказательство отсутствия документа с требованиями, в котором четко прописана необходимость проверки совместимости этого сайта. 2) вопросы — это одна из наиболее простых и эффективных техник выявления требований. Если что-то в документах остается непонятным — задавайте вопросы.
- Этот этап позволяет организовать процесс тестирования, сделать его прозрачным и слаженным.
- Все тестировщики могут составлять чеклисты, тест-кейсы и баг-репорты.
- Кто-то использует мнемонику CIRCUS MATTA, кто-то расширяет список под себя и команду.
Это не только технические знания, но и аналитическое мышление, постоянное стремление учиться и адаптироваться к изменениям. Их работа включает в себя qa manual курсы как рутинные действия, выполняемые автоматически, так и интеллектуальные задачи, требующие креативных подходов и глубокого погружения в профильные темы. Этим эксперты тестирования по-настоящему увлекаются и развиваются в своей области. По несоответствиям создаются отчеты о проблемах – документы, которые направляются на анализ в группу разработчиков с целью определения причины возникновения несоответствия. Примером значительного финансового ущерба, связанного с отсутствием тестирования, является случай компании Samsung в 2013 году.
Это гораздо проще сделать на этапе тестирования требований, чем исправлять баги в готовом продукте. Есть понятие “Цена дефекта”, она растет на протяжении жизненного цикла разработки, и чем раньше мы найдем дефект, тем эта цена будет меньше. Роль тестировщика в процессе работы с технической документацией крайне важна. Взаимодействие между тестировщиком и техническим писателем является ключевым для обеспечения качества и актуальности документации.
.png)
Как правило, такой профессионал становится незаменимой частью команды разработки, помогая обнаруживать и исправлять ошибки с нуля. Тестирование программного обеспечения — это обширный процесс, который включает различные подходы, методы и уровни анализа. Каждый вид тестирования преследует свои цели и помогает обеспечить высокое качество продукта, минимизируя возможные риски. Рассмотрим основные виды тестирования, которые применяются в зависимости от сценариев, условий запуска, уровня автоматизации и других факторов.
.jpeg)
Типы Тестовой Документации
Для этой задачи стоит выделить опытного специалиста, который «собаку съел» именно на тестировании требований. И конечно же, гораздо лучше, когда документацию проверяют сразу несколько человек (тестировщиков и разработчиков). Все они смогут задать правильные вопросы, исходя из своих профессиональных особенностей. Такой подход значительно повысит шансы на то, что тестирование требований будет проведено должным образом.
Важно помнить, что такой подход может привести к серьезным последствиям, включая сбои в работе программного обеспечения, утечку данных, потерю репутации и финансовые убытки. 1) Спецификации требований к программному обеспечению.2) Функциональные документы. Постарайтесь задокументировать все, что вам необходимо для понимания вашей работы, и что вам нужно будет предоставить заинтересованным сторонам, когда это потребуется. В моей практике была один https://deveducation.com/ продукт, в котором имелась немного запутанная функциональность. Как же сделать так, чтобы продукт получился качественным и хорошо продаваемым?
